Osimhen agrees to join Galatasaray, seeks revision of Napoli contract

Victor Osimhen has reportedly agreed to join Turkish club Galatasaray, putting an end to the uncertainty surrounding his footballing future.

Osimhen, who has had a strained relationship with Napoli since a social media incident last season, was close to joining Saudi Arabian side Al Ahli and later Chelsea, but both deals fell through. Paris Saint-Germain had also expressed interest in the Super Eagles forward.

According to reports, Osimhen has now agreed to join Galatasaray but is seeking a revision of certain terms in his contract with Napoli.

It is also understood that Galatasaray has arranged a jet to bring him over once an agreement is finalized.

Fabrizio Romano explained Osimhen’s new demands, stating, “Victor Osimhen has accepted to join Galatasaray on loan.

Understand Osimhen is now asking for the release clause at Napoli to be reduced to €75 million from €130 million.

He also wants a break clause for January in case top clubs approach him for a move. Final details are being discussed.”

Galatasaray is expected to cover €9-10 million of Osimhen’s salary until the end of the season.

The loan deal with Napoli does not include any buy option or obligation clause.

Osimhen, 25, will join his national team colleagues for the upcoming qualifiers this month.
